Midjourney, a leading AI image generation platform, has taken a significant step towards wider accessibility by opening its website to all users, offering 25 free AI-generated images to newcomers.

Expanded access and free offerings: Midjourney’s decision to open its website to all users marks a strategic shift in its approach to user acquisition and engagement.

  • Previously, the website was limited to an “alpha” version, accessible only to users who had generated a certain number of images.
  • New users can now sign up using either a Google account or a Discord account, simplifying the onboarding process.
  • The platform is offering approximately 25 free image generations to new users, providing a substantial sample of its capabilities without requiring an upfront commitment.

User experience and functionality: The Midjourney web interface offers a range of features designed to enhance the image generation process and user interaction.

  • Users can create images in sets of four by inputting text prompts, allowing for quick experimentation and iteration.
  • The platform provides adjustable settings such as aspect ratio, stylization, weirdness, and variety, giving users fine-grained control over their generated images.
  • Different sections of the website include an image creator, editor, “Organize” tab for managing generated images, and a “Chat” tab for community interaction.

Existing user considerations: Midjourney has also taken steps to ensure a smooth transition for its current user base.

  • Existing users can sign in using their Discord accounts to maintain their image history and continue their work seamlessly.
  • An option to merge Discord and Google accounts is available under the “account” tab, allowing for unified access across platforms.

Competitive landscape: Midjourney’s move comes amidst increasing competition in the AI image generation space.

  • The platform faces competition from emerging players like xAI’s Grok 2 and Ideogram 2, which are also vying for market share in this rapidly evolving sector.
  • Midjourney is currently embroiled in a lawsuit from artists over copyright infringement, highlighting the ongoing legal challenges faced by AI image generation companies.

Potential impact and implications: The expansion of Midjourney’s accessibility could have far-reaching effects on the AI image generation market and creative industries.

  • By offering free generations and easier access, Midjourney is likely to attract a more diverse range of users, potentially expanding its user base significantly.
  • This move may accelerate the adoption of AI-generated imagery in various fields, from graphic design to marketing and beyond.
  • The increased accessibility could also spark further discussions about the role of AI in creative processes and its impact on traditional artists and designers.
